The Long History of Fuel Cells
Fuel cells have a history going back more
than 200 years. Groundbreaking early
19th-century British chemist Sir Humphry
Davy-who also isolated the elements
calcium, strontium, barium, magnesium,
and boron in 1807 and 1808-posited
the electrochemical principle behind fuel
cells in 1801. He reasoned that it would
be possible to reverse the splitting of water
into hydrogen and oxygen, generating
a current. British chemist, physicist, and
lawyer William Grove generally gets credit
for the first fuel cell, in 1839, which he
called a " gas voltaic battery. "
Grove showed that a reaction between
hydrogen and oxygen with a platinum catalyst
could produce a current. At the time,
it was simply an interesting phenomenon
with unknown practical applications.
In 1889, Charles Langer and Ludwig
Mond coined the term " fuel cell " as they
tried unsuccessfully to make a practical
device using air and coal gas. Many other
researchers also tried to use fuel cells to
convert coal directly into electricity, but
that was a dead end.
In 1932, Francis Bacon, an engineering
professor at Cambridge in England, invented
a rudimentary fuel cell, but it took
him until 1959 to demonstrate a working,
5-kW design. At about the same time,
American Harry Karl Ihrig rolled out a fuel
cell-powered farm tractor that was modified
to use a 15-kW (20-hp) unit. The U.S.
Air Force, working with Allis-Chalmers,
soon developed fuel-cell vehicles, including
a forklift and a golf cart.
The
simple,
emissions-free
technology
proved a good fit for certain highly
specialized applications like space travel.
NASA in the late 1950s and 1960s used
fuel cells for its manned space missions,
refining proton-exchange membrane
technology using platinum as a catalyst,
which they used in the Gemini program.
A Pratt-Whitney subsidiary, later acquired
by United Technologies Corp., developed
a 1.5-kW fuel cell for use in the Apollo
program (Figure 3) and the space shuttle,

3. Space power. Each Apollo spacecraft
carried three fuel cells like this one.
They generated electricity for the spacecraft
by combining hydrogen and oxygen. A
by-product of the reaction was water, which
the crew could drink. Courtesy: Creative
Commons/James Humphreys

These early designs worked well enough,
but they were far too expensive for general
use. It took the Arab oil embargo and
the subsequent dramatic increase in oil
prices during the 1970s to spur new fuel
cell ventures. Many of these were aimed
at transportation, and automakers worldwide
experimented with fuel-cell electric
vehicles. Developments around molten
carbonate fuel cells in the 1970s and
1980s, funded by government and electric
utilities, raised the prospect of reforming
natural gas for hydrogen to power large
stationary power plants.
By the turn of the century, the prospect
of utility-scale fuel cells had largely faded
and attention turned to smaller systems,
for transportation applications and for
distributed power on the customer side of
the electric meter. Those two applications
continue to dominate, but neither has yet
resulted in fuel cells becoming anything
other than niche players.

A Path to Profits?
Fuel cells remain a relatively expensive
means of generating power, and repeated
stumbles by some fuel-cell companies make
it clear the sector is still in search of a profitable
niche. Could it be CCS? Thus far, no
other CCS technology comes close to offering
what fuel cells could, with all other approaches
being parasitic drains-sometimes
very large ones-on generation. If FCE and
ExxonMobil can make it work cost-effectively,
CCS could be the " killer app " fuel cells
have been seeking for decades. ■
